jumphook.pas

来自「键盘鼠标动作的记录和回放」· PAS 代码 · 共 34 行

PAS
34
字号
unit  JumpHook;

interface

procedure JumpHookOn;
procedure JumpHookOff;

implementation

uses
  Windows,Messages;

var
  JumpHookHandle: DWORD; 

function JumpHookPro(nCode: Integer; wParam: WPARAM; lParam: LPARAM): LRESULT; stdcall;
begin
  Result:= CallNextHookEx(JumpHookHandle, nCode, wParam, lParam);
end;


procedure JumpHookOn;
begin
  JumpHookHandle := SetWindowsHookEx(WH_GETMESSAGE, @JumpHookPro, HInstance, 0);
end;

procedure JumpHookOff;
begin
  UnHookWindowsHookEx(JumpHookHandle);
end;

end.

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?